New Iron Range transportation building gets approval – Northern News Now


DULUTH, Minn. (Northern News Now) – A new public works transportation building is going to be built on the Range to serve the region.

The St. Louis County Board voted to authorize a bond sale of $45 million to build the new transportation building in Balkan Township.

It will serve Hibbing, Chisholm and surrounding communities.

Currently the public works operates out of a facility in Hibbing, sharing the space with the city and MnDOT.

However, the county’s space is in the oldest part of the building and is no longer efficient.

The county is using revenue from the transportation sales tax to pay for the project, so there is no impact on property taxes.

Construction is expected to start this fall and be complete by the summer of 2027.
